用python写出下列程序代码1.运用输入输出函数编写程序,能将华氏温度转换成摄氏温度。换算公式:C=(F-32)*5/9,其中C为摄氏温度,F为华氏温度。 2.编写程序,根据输入的长和宽,计算矩形的面积并输出。 3.编写程序,输入三个学生的成绩计算平均分并输出。 4.根据以下叙述写出正确的条件表达式: 有语文(Chinese)、数学(Math)、英语(English)三门课程,均采用百分制,60及以上为及格,90及以上为优秀。 三门课程都及格; 至少一门课程及格; 语文及格且数学或者英语优秀。
时间: 2024-03-26 15:38:04 浏览: 85
1. 华氏温度转摄氏温度的程序代码:
```python
f = float(input("请输入华氏温度:"))
c = (f - 32) * 5 / 9
print("摄氏温度为:", c)
```
2. 计算矩形面积的程序代码:
```python
length = float(input("请输入矩形的长:"))
width = float(input("请输入矩形的宽:"))
area = length * width
print("矩形的面积为:", area)
```
3. 计算学生平均分的程序代码:
```python
score1 = float(input("请输入第一个学生的成绩:"))
score2 = float(input("请输入第二个学生的成绩:"))
score3 = float(input("请输入第三个学生的成绩:"))
avg = (score1 + score2 + score3) / 3
print("三个学生的平均分为:", avg)
```
4. 根据叙述写出条件表达式的程序代码:
```python
# 三门课程都及格
if Chinese >= 60 and Math >= 60 and English >= 60:
print("三门课程都及格")
# 至少一门课程及格
if Chinese >= 60 or Math >= 60 or English >= 60:
print("至少一门课程及格")
# 语文及格且数学或者英语优秀
if Chinese >= 60 and (Math >= 90 or English >= 90):
print("语文及格且数学或者英语优秀")
```
注意,以上代码中的变量 `Chinese`、`Math`、`English` 需要在运行之前先进行定义和赋值。
阅读全文